The "rotten egg" smell is the biggest red flag. If you smell gas or hear a hissing sound, immediately turn off the gas at the cylinder, open windows to ventilate, and call a professional from a safe location. Your installer or technician will confirm the details based on your setup.
It's a warning sign of incomplete combustion. This wastes gas and can produce dangerous carbon monoxide. It's typically caused by blocked burners or an incorrect air-to-gas mixture that needs professional adjustment.
If the repair cost exceeds 50% of a new appliance's price, or the unit is very old, replacement is often the better long-term choice. Repair is usually cheaper for common faults.
In South Africa, it is illegal and extremely dangerous for anyone other than a SAQCC Gas registered professional to work on gas systems. Doing so puts your property, your family, and your insurance at risk. Absolutely not.
A certified technician should inspect the entire installation, including regulators and hoses, to prevent potential issues. Every 12 months is the best practice for safety and efficiency. This is worth noting for Sunninghill homeowners.
